What is the Delay Effect?

The delay effect is a commonly used audio effect that creates an echo-like sound by repeating the original audio signal after a certain amount of time. It can be used to add space and depth to your tracks, as well as create interesting rhythmic patterns. Garageband offers a range of options to adjust the delay effect, allowing you to customize the sound to your liking.

Step 5: Adjust the Delay Parameters

Once you have selected the Delay effect, you will see a set of parameters that you can adjust. These parameters include:

  • Time: This parameter determines the amount of time between the original audio signal and the delayed signal. You can adjust it to create shorter or longer delays.
  • Feedback: This parameter controls the number of times the delayed signal is repeated. Increasing the feedback will create more repetitions and a more pronounced echo effect.
  • Level: This parameter adjusts the volume of the delayed signal. You can increase or decrease the level to make the delay effect more or less prominent in your mix.

Experiment with these parameters to find the desired delay effect for your track. You can also try out different presets available in Garageband to get started.
